Type 1 Diabetes is a chronic condition in which the pancreas produces little or no insulin, a hormone essential for converting sugar into energy. It requires constant management and monitoring, including regular visits to healthcare providers for check-ups, insulin adjustments, and overall health maintenance. Missing these appointments can have serious consequences for individuals with Type 1 Diabetes, both medically and financially.

Johnson has a rich heritage dating back to its founding in 1792. The town was named after William Samuel Johnson, an American jurist who played a significant role in drafting the United States Constitution.
